Integrated Components
- SageMaker - build, train, and deploy
- Polly - text to speech
- Rekognition - video analysis service
- Lambda - run code without managing servers
- Simple Queue Service (SQS) - message queuing
- Simple Notification Service (SNS) - pub/sub messaging and mobile notifications
- Simple Storage Service (S3) - object storage
- Management Console - manage web services
